In this episode of Lifetime Talks, hosts Jamie Martin and David Freeman interview Dr. Elizabeth Yurth from Boulder Longevity Institute about the role of hormones in health and longevity. Dr. Yurth discusses the importance of sex hormones (estrogen, progesterone, and testosterone) in both men and women, highlighting their impact on brain, heart, bone, and muscle health. She addresses the effects of hormone disruptors like microplastics and glyphosates, the risks associated with birth control pills, and the misinterpreted data from the Women's Health Initiative study. The conversation covers hormone replacement therapy, the significance of early intervention during perimenopause, and the importance of understanding individual hormone metabolism. Dr. Yurth emphasizes the need for individuals to advocate for their health, stay informed about hormone-related issues, and find healthcare providers who are willing to work collaboratively.
